Definitely not the first. Canada has a history of electing party leaders from outside Parliament, who then call general elections or stand for elections in a by-election.
I came across a post on Twitter that there may have been as many as six Canadian Prime Ministers who became Prime Ministers without a seat in Parliament.
Note that it is possible even in the UK to become a Prime Minister without a seat in Parliament. However both major parties have internal rules that their leader must be a sitting MP.
Found an article about Canadian Prime Ministers without a seat in Parliament.
https://nationalpost.com/news/canada/canada-unelected-prime-ministers
